On Sunday, October 28, Windsor Park Stories will begin one of the most ambitious projects in the history of our series. We call it Heart Scene: A Journey of Discovery and Recovery.

It is a personal story. It is my story about heart disease, open heart surgery, a second chance at life and all of the wonderful people Kitch and I met during the single greatest medical challenge of our lives.

You see, on Memorial Day 2007, I experienced two major cardiac events that led to tests, hospitalization and surgery. It is now 16 weeks since my open heart surgery. Three days a week I participate in a cardiac rehabilitation program with a wonderful group of people.

The rest of my time is devoted to producing our Heart Scene Journey, and what a journey it has been. It reunited us with important people in our lives that we had not seen in a long time. It connected us with a group of King's College graduates who literally saved my life. It introduced us to a team of doctors, nurses and technicians at Wilkes-Barre General Hospital who are among the best in their field.

The leader of this team is Dr. Michael Harostock. Together with his wife, Beverly, they did everything in their power to help us with this project. If it is a success, it is because of their help.

For Kitch and me, my quadruple by-pass surgery was one of the most positive learning experiences of our lives, and one that we will never forget.

Our understanding of what happened to us is real. Our gratitude is unmeasurable. We are working hard day by day to build our strength and fully recover.

The only way we can reciprocate for the kindness we have experienced is to tell the story so that others will know about the human and community treasures that are here in the Wyoming Valley.

We hope that our Heart Scene Journey will help others to identify the signs of heart disease and get early intervention. We hope these episodes of Windsor Park Stories will lay to rest the popular myth that you must go outside our region to get quality medical care.

We hope that Heart Scene: A Journey of Discovery and Recovery will help many unsuspecting, potential heart patients to take the steps that are necessary to guarantee a healthy heart.
